I know many of you hate the ONE layer cards - me included if I'm honest, as they never feel quite adequate enough for a card and if I've coloured it ... as is the case with this one, it bleeds through to the inside! My trick ... make the card, photograph, post on your blog and then crop it to fit on top of a card base! 

Here I've used my absolute favourite HLS set 'Butterfly Birthday' stamping and masking a collection of butterflies before colouring in rainbow-ish fashion with Promarkers. I masked the area for the sentiment too then hand-drew around the box for added definition before stamping. Finally I used a few enamel dots, which if the truth be told, are hiding a couple of 'innocent' smudges! I'm such a messy worker!

As we are fast approaching that 'Autumnal Season' I've gone with a Halloween Theme on my card.


I started with an inky blended panel of distress inks to create a night sky then added some silhouette pumkins, from Clearly Besottedm masking as I went along. The sentiments are from the same set.

Here's my card and if you follow my blog regularly you might notice I do like to get messy with inks and watercolours now and again. Distress inks are my go to favourite and whenever I've got some pigment left on my craft sheet I like to 'dab it up' by smooshing it onto some watercolour card. I've now a never-ending supply of smooshy backgrounds and here's one with a little bit of perfect pearls mixed with the water to add some shimmer.


Supplies used:
Dies: Simon Says Stamp: Sketched Heart & My Favourite Things: Pierced Rectangle Stax
Stamps: Happy Little Stampers - Wish You Were Here sentiment
Sparkly sprinkles from HLS and Distress inks to create my smooshed background.

I started out by blending a range of Distress inks from yellow tones through to red on a piece of watercolour card. I can't resist a little flicking and spritzing of water with perfect pearls! Followed by some heat embossing of one of the blooms from 'Especially For You' the sentiment is also heat embossed and from the Fun Birthday Sentiments set. A strip of design paper and some gems to my flower centres finishes my card.

I think my all-time favourite HLS set (so far) has to be Butterfly Birthday,
which I've used here, especially as I've got the matching dies too!
First of all I die-cut a scalloped rectangle using WPlus9 Sunshine Layers dies
then die-cut my butterflies out of the same panel. The butterflies were then
stamped and heat-embossed before colouring with distress inks then popped
back into the die-cut apertures but slightly raised on glue-dots to add some dimension
to the wings. Finally the sentiment is heat embossed in the same powder which is 
also from Happy Little Stampers: Fun birthday Sentiments

So here goes with my stencil inspired card and I've got another TWO-fer!


Both of them start with the inking of my Concentric Grid stencil from
My Favourite Things in Distress Inks: Tumbled Glass, Salty Ocean and
Mermaid Lagoon ... then the fun starts with cracking open my HLS goodies
to accent the stencilled panels! So here's what I've used:

Everyday Sentiments, Fun Birthday Sentiments, Mix Mash
and Mixed Media Fun (don't you just love 'neat' splatters' - I'm hooked!)

To add a little more depth to my panels I've inked the edges too and beneath the
sentiment panel on the second card I've blended Mermaid Lagoon and Salty Ocean
Distress inks before laying my stencil on top and dabbing through it with
a damp kitchen towel to lift some of the ink. Just another little trick with stencils
that I keep seeing my teamie Anita use but haven't had the nerve to try!
